Augustine of Canterbury (born first third of the 6th century – died probably 26 May 604) was a Benedictine monk who became the first Archbishop of Canterbury in the year 597. County days in the United Kingdom are relatively recent observances, formed to celebrate the cultural heritage of a particular British county.
